Adaptable Cargo Handling for Oversized Shipments
The 20' High Cube Open Top Container stands out as a remarkably versatile solution for the transportation of get more info oversized or irregular cargo. This container type provides exceptional height and open access, making it ideal for shipments that exceed standard container dimensions. Its robust design ensures reliable transport, while its open-top configuration facilitates easy loading and unloading of bulky items. Whether you're moving construction equipment, machinery, or oversized products, the 20' High Cube Open Top Container offers a dependable solution for your logistics needs.

Choosing the Right Solution for Your Demands
When it comes to shipping your goods, understanding the variations between high cube and standard containers is crucial. High cube containers offer increased height, allowing you to transport more amount of load in each container. This can be particularly advantageous for companies dealing with substantial products. However, standard containers remain a popular choice due to their cost-effectiveness and universally obtainable infrastructure.
- Evaluate the dimensions of your load.
- Establish your spending limit.
- Investigate the transportation routes available for each option.
